  • The Chair Company Season 1 Episode 1 - What is a Mall
    Off-kilter, unhinged, and painfully hilarious — HBO’s The Chair Company is everything we hoped it would be. In Episode 1, “Life Goes By Too F**king Fast, It Really Does,” we meet Ron Trosper, a fragile project manager whose life starts to spiral after a chair collapses mid-presentation. But what starts as slapstick embarrassment quickly turns into a full-blown corporate thriller — or maybe just a mental breakdown in real-time.Brandon & Chanel dive into:Ron’s anxiety-riddled descent from mall project lead to potential whistleblowerThe weirdly intense investigation into chair manufacturer TeccaA brutal necklace-ripping HR incidentAccidental upskirting, hiding in offices, and a wheelbarrow subplot for the agesThe show’s surprisingly sharp satire of masculinity, stress culture, and internalized shameIs there a conspiracy? Or is Ron just unwell? Either way, The Chair Company blends Tim Robinson’s sketch-comedy energy with serialized storytelling and Enemy of the State visual cues.
